Contribution Guide

Walter’s code is currently hosted on GitLab at abre/walter. If you’re not familiar with GitLab, it’s very similar to GitHub; you can sign in with your GitHub account, and then fork, modify and file merge requests.

Setting Up

  • To install Walter for development, run pip install -e .[dev,docs].
  • Tests are written using pytest; just run the command pytest to run them.
  • Documentation is built with Sphinx. You can just run cd docs; make html and browse the generated HTML files, but if you install devd and modd, then run the command modd, you’ll get a nice live-reloading view served on localhost port 8000 (or run e.g. env PORT=1337 modd to serve on a different port).
